Queer-affirmative therapy is an evidence-based psychotherapy that embraces the LGBTQIA+ identities, relationships and experiences as valid and healthy, rather than viewing them as a mental health problem. A gender-affirming therapist is someone who understands that gender is deeply personal and doesn’t try to fit you into boxes. You can ask if they’ve worked with trans or non-binary clients before, and if they respect pronouns and chosen names.
